Inadequate Flashing Installment



Choosing the appropriate materials isn't the only factor that can bring about roof troubles; insufficient blinking installation can likewise develop significant problems. Flashing is vital for routing water far from susceptible areas,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roof covering valleys. If it's not set up properly, you take the chance of water invasion, which can lead to mold and mildew development and architectural damage.

When you install flashing, ensure it's the right kind for your roofing system's style and the regional environment. For example, steel flashing is typically a lot more sturdy than plastic in locations with heavy rainfall or snow. Make certain the flashing overlaps suitably and is safeguarded firmly to stop gaps where water can permeate with.

You must likewise take notice of the setup angle. Blinking need to be placed to route water away from the house, not toward it.

If you're not sure about the installment procedure or the materials needed, consult an expert. They can help determine the very best flashing choices and ensure everything is set up appropriately, safeguarding your home from possible water damages.

Neglecting Ventilation Needs



While several home owners concentrate on the visual and structural facets of roofing system installment, overlooking air flow needs can lead to serious long-term repercussions. Correct ventilation is vital for regulating temperature and dampness degrees in your attic, protecting against concerns like mold and mildew growth, wood rot, and ice dams. If you do not set up sufficient air flow, you're setting your roof covering up for failure.

To avoid this blunder, first, evaluate your home's particular ventilation requirements. A well balanced system commonly includes both consumption and exhaust vents to promote air movement. Guarantee you have actually installed so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the optimal of your roof covering. This mix permits hot air to run away while cooler air gets in, maintaining your attic room space comfy.
